Abstract
A series of isosteviol derivatives such as aromatic esters and amino acid amides were synthesized. Their effects on seed germination and root elongation of the crop plants, Capsicum annuum, Lens culinaris medicus, Lycopersicon esculentum, Trifollium spp. and Triticum vulgare, were studied. The derivatives could be arranged into four groups: (1) seed germination inhibitors (2) root elongation inhibitors (3) root elongation inducers (4) general inhibitors.
